The planning, zoning and development function is responsible
for administration of the short-and long-range planning and community
development programs for the Town in accordance with the Pennsylvania
Municipalities Planning Code (1968, P.L. 805, No. 247, as amended)
and works in conjunction with the Town's Planning Commission
and Zoning Hearing Board.
Performance of this function shall be under the responsibility
of the Chief Administrative Officer who may delegate responsibility
to another administrative staff member, utilize independent planning
and development consultants and/or rely on county, state and federal
governmental, intergovernmental or nonprofit agencies to assist in
the completion of various tasks and responsibilities.
The duties of this function shall be to:
A. Perform the various duties and exercise the powers as prescribed
by the Pennsylvania Municipalities Planning Code, including, but not
limited to, conducting zoning studies; preparation and periodic comprehensive
revisions of the zoning regulations and map; preparation of subdivision
standards and regulations and conducting periodic reviews and suggesting
revisions; conducting renewal studies and community renewal programs;
identifying renewal areas; determining development standards; and
recommending use changes.
B. Prepare, review, and maintain plans for human services, including
health care, education, employment, recreation, and other social services
and coordinate such plans with the plans for the physical and economic
development of the Town;
C. Prepare, review, and maintain the comprehensive plan of the Town
including data collection, mapping, and analyses;
D. Participate in the development of long-range fiscal plans and preparation
of proposals for the acquisition of federal, state, and other funding
for capital improvements; and
E. Serve as secretariat to the Planning Commission by recording minutes
of meetings, maintaining files, handling correspondence, and related
duties.
